Beast Mode Truckin is seeking Class A CDL drivers, including new CDL graduates, to operate 53' dry van trailers on regional, 100% no‑touch drop‑and‑hook freight in the Great Lakes/Upper Midwest area.
This role offers predictable regional lanes and weekly home time on weekends.
Key responsibilities
Operate 53' dry van trailers safely and professionally in regional lanes.
Follow assigned routes and schedules; perform drop‑and‑hook and no‑touch deliveries.
Maintain accurate logs and required documentation in accordance with federal and company regulations.
Perform pre‑ and post‑trip inspections and report maintenance or safety issues promptly.
Training Out‑of‑route (OTR) training with a trainer for approximately 4–6 weeks for drivers with under 6 months’ experience. New graduates are eligible for trainee pay during this period.
Schedule & equipment
Great Lakes / Upper Midwest regional lanes.
Weekly home time on weekends; drivers must be available for day or night shifts.
Typical weekly mileage: approximately 1,700–2,200 miles.
Company‑maintained 53' dry van trailers; majority drop & hook operations.
Compensation & benefits $1,100–$1,500 per week (depending on miles and experience).Base pay: $0.56–$0.64 per mile (depending on experience).Trainee pay: $900 per week for approximately 4–6 weeks.
Stop pay: $15 per stop.
Monthly performance bonus: $0.06 per mile (eligibility: over 9,200 miles driven, no accidents, fuel at 7 MPG).Full benefits after 30 days, including medical, dental, 401(k), and paid time off.
Minimum requirements
Minimum age 21 and valid Class A CDL.Graduated from an accredited truck driving school with at least 120 hours.
Fairly clean driving record: no major accidents, tickets, or suspensions within the past 5 years; no DUI convictions in the past 5 years.
No felony or misdemeanor convictions within the past 10 years.
Stable work history (generally no more than 6 months unemployed in the last year or 1 year in the last 3 years; exceptions for schooling/training may apply).Not terminated from most recent job for cause.
Able to pass pre‑employment urine and hair drug screening and required background checks.
Selection considerations
Candidates are evaluated on driving history, background screening, employment verification, and demonstrated commitment to safety and professionalism.
